G241 EVH is a 1989 Land Rover 110 in Blue with a 2,495c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 24 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 58.3%.
Across all 1989 Land Rover 110 models, the average MOT pass rate is 65.1% with a typical mileage of 137,256 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Land Rover 110 fails its MOT is brake pipe excessively corroded, accounting for 450 recorded failures. If you're considering buying G241 EVH,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Land Rover 110 typically stays on UK roads for around 55 years. At 37 years old, this Land Rover 110 is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
